'The Dictator': Barack Obama Wants to Take Down Sacha Baron Cohen — VIDEO

Two days ago, Sacha Baron Cohen caused a stir when he made an unexpected pop-in at the CinemaCon gathering in Las Vegas ... as General Aladeen. Those in attendance probably would've been a little more comfortable with today's Dictator news: The movie's opening scene has made its way online.

The video introduces viewers in earnest to Cohen's dictator in a newsy segment, with (an edited-in) President Obama weighing in on the nuclear ""standoff between the world community and the rogue North African nation of Wadiya"": ""I will take no options off the table, and I mean what I say,"" says the prez in a clip whose mere clearance by all of Washington, D.C., is mildly surprising.

The end of the clip features the Olympic-race scene — wherein Aladeen shoots his competitors to ensure a first-place finish — with which we're all probably familiar by now. But it's no less chuckle-worthy this time around! Check out the clip below and The Dictator when it hits theaters, May 16.
